Ingredients
Serves 2 (easily doubled!)
The Heart of the Packets
2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 6 oz each), pounded to ½-inch thickness (key for even cooking!)
1 cup fresh pineapple chunks (canned works in a pinch—drain well!)
½ red bell pepper, thinly sliced
1 carrot, julienned or thinly sliced
1 small zucchini, halved lengthwise and sliced
2 green onions, finely chopped (for garnish)
The Flavor Soul
¼ cup teriyaki sauce (low-sodium if preferred—Kikkoman or San-J)
1 tbsp olive oil or sesame oil (sesame adds depth!)
1 tsp fresh ginger, grated (your secret weapon—don’t skip!)
1 clove garlic, minced (optional but glorious)
Salt & freshly ground black pepper to taste
✅ Joye’s Pro Tip: Pound chicken gently between plastic wrap with a rolling pin or skillet—tenderizes and ensures quick, even cooking.
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Prep & Preheat
→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
→ Cut two 18-inch sheets of heavy-duty aluminum foil (or double-layer regular foil).
2. Build the Packets (The Quiet Magic)
→ Place one chicken breast in the center of each foil sheet.
→ Drizzle evenly with olive oil; season with salt and pepper.
→ Top with pineapple chunks, bell pepper, carrot, and zucchini.
→ In a small bowl, whisk teriyaki sauce, grated ginger, and garlic (if using).
→ Pour sauce evenly over each packet.
✅ Joye’s touch: Sprinkle sesame seeds over the sauce for nutty crunch.
3. Seal with Care
→ Bring foil sides together over the filling.
→ Fold edges tightly in 1-inch folds to create a sealed “envelope” (no steam escapes!).
→ Place packets seam-side up on a rimmed baking sheet (catches leaks).
4. Bake to Perfection
→ Bake 25–30 minutes, until:
✓ Chicken reaches 165°F internally
✓ Foil puffs gently with steam
✓ Veggies are tender-crisp (no mush!)
✅ Pro tip: Rotate sheet halfway for even cooking.
5. Serve with Joy
→ Carefully open packets away from your face—steam is HOT!
→ Sprinkle generously with chopped green onions.
→ Serve immediately—forks ready, plates optional! (Eat straight from the foil for camping charm.)
Tips for Perfect Packets (Joye-Approved!)
🔸 Don’t overload the foil. Overcrowding = soggy veggies. Keep layers thin.
🔸 Seal tightly. Steam is your friend—it cooks and flavors everything.
🔸 Use heavy-duty foil. Prevents tears and leaks (regular foil = double layer).
🔸 Pound the chicken. Thick breasts stay raw in the center—½-inch is ideal.

Storage & Make-Ahead Tips
Fridge (uncooked): Assemble packets, refrigerate up to 24 hours. Bake +5 mins.
Fridge (cooked): Not recommended—veggies lose crunch. Cook fresh!
Freezer (uncooked): Freeze packets on baking sheet, then bag. Thaw overnight; bake +10 mins.
Camping hack: Pre-assemble packets at home; bake over campfire coals (15–20 mins, flip once).
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I use frozen pineapple?
A: Yes! Thaw completely and pat dry—wet pineapple steams the chicken.
Q: Why is my chicken dry?
A: Likely overcooked or not pounded thin. Next time: use a thermometer and pound to ½ inch.
Q: Can I make it gluten-free?
A: Absolutely! Use GF teriyaki sauce (San-J or Kikkoman GF) and tamari.
Q: Can I use chicken thighs?
A: Yes! Bake 30–35 mins (thighs are more forgiving).
Q: Can I add rice inside the packet?
A: Not recommended—rice needs more liquid and time to cook. Serve rice beside the packet.
